Block Summary

Block Height
1663782
Block Hash
ebc59ff968006be8342558f88258adf2a7d7af4672cc3a1a96401552d97c64f0
Block Size
615 bytes
Block Weight
2,352 bytes
Timestamp
2 months ago (2025-07-04 15:30:32)
Block Reward
25 RUNES
Difficulty
5571378.589793612
Merkle Root
feea5dbd5d0ace4b4e6b90dfad19c8cd28585f84b69547c531cb60c37098e697
Transactions
2
Transactions